Abstract
본 실시 예는 무선충전 단말기에 관한 것이다. 본 실시 예에 따른 무선충전 단말기는 무선전력 송신기로부터 전력을 수신하는 무선전력 수신부; 상기 수신된 전력으로 충전되는 배터리; 상기 배터리의 충전을 제어하고, 충전 시 상기 배터리의 온도 정보를 감지하는 전원 제어부; 상기 전원 제어부로부터 상기 배터리의 온도 정보를 수신하고, 상기 배터리의 온도 정보에 기초하여 상기 배터리의 충전 제어 신호를 출력하는 단말 제어부;를 포함한다. 상기 무선전력 수신부는 상기 배터리의 온도 정보를 감지하고, 상기 배터리의 온도 정보 및 상기 충전 제어 신호를 무선전력 송신기에 전송한다.
